A satirical novella written against Stalinist Russia that is known for its great use of allegory to convey its message. This classic is worth reading because its message is still relevant till this day, most of the characters in this book resembles someone in real life. This book is an excellent, disturbing and important read that can be finished in one sitting.

Spoilers from this point onwards:
People seem to forget that Snowball was not a perfect pig either, not to say that Napoleon was a saint obviously but Snowball didn’t say anything when the wind-fallen apples were added to their meals, and as the milk from the cows disappeared he didnt take up any issue with it. although he was far better than Napoleon he was still a pig.
